The Role
Reporting directly to the Project Management team, the Project Coordinator will play a critical role in supporting projects from pre-construction through to completion and handover. You will be responsible for coordinating project administration, tracking progress, managing documentation, supporting procurement activities, and ensuring effective communication between site teams, subcontractors, suppliers, consultants, and clients. The successful candidate will be capable of managing multiple live projects simultaneously while maintaining excellent attention to detail and ensuring deadlines are consistently achieved.

Key Responsibilities
- Support Project Managers and Site Managers in the day-to-day delivery of multiple fit-out and refurbishment projects
- Coordinate project mobilisation activities including documentation, inductions, permits, and logistics planning
- Assist with the preparation and management of project programmes, progress trackers, and reporting schedules
- Monitor project milestones and proactively follow up on outstanding actions to maintain programme delivery
- Prepare and distribute meeting agendas, minutes, action trackers, and progress reports
- Coordinate procurement schedules and material deliveries in line with project timelines
- Liaise with suppliers and subcontractors regarding lead times, delivery dates, and technical documentation
- Maintain accurate and up-to-date project records and filing systems
- Compile and manage construction documentation including RAMS, site registers, O&M manuals, warranties, and handover packs
- Support the coordination of site visits, progress meetings, and client updates

Candidate Requirements
The ideal candidate will have previous experience within the construction, interiors, or fit-out sector and demonstrate excellent organisational and communication skills.
- Previous experience in a Project Coordinator, Construction Administrator, Document Controller, or similar role within construction or interiors
- Strong administrative and organisational abilities with excellent attention to detail
- Ability to manage multiple projects and competing priorities within tight deadlines
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ills with a professional approach to stakeholder management
- Competent in Microsoft Office Suite including Excel, Word, Outlook, and Teams
- Experience managing construction documentation and project reporting processes
- Understanding of construction project lifecycle and site operations
- Knowledge of health & safety documentation and construction compliance processes
